Imperial Grand Premier Female A wonderful class of a lady neuters and a privilege to judge. Oly Chapman-Beer s OB, IGRCH & IGRPR CATAMARIAN EVITA (BUR a) FN 13/08/10. Gorgeous Burmese lady neuter, beautiful balanced throughout. Short wedge with blunt muzzle, broad rounded top of head and very good width at the cheek bones, ears medium in size, broad at the base and rounded at the tips, set well apart and to follow the upper part of the face. Gentle curve to brow with good depth of head in profile, distinct nose break, short straight nose that lines up with the chin and the bite is level, Lovely eyes for expression, large and lustrous, slanting slightly to the nose with a rounded lower line, golden yellow in colour. Medium length body with rounded chest, has very good muscle-tone and substance, slender legs in proportion and neat oval paws, tail tapers to a rounded a tip and balances. Mid blue coat with silvery sheen to the head and paws, super coat texture, beautifully short and close with the desired satin-like feel to it. Excellent temperament and presented in super condition. R Jones CH & UK IGRPR PERSY LARENDA (MCO f 03 22) FN. Another lovely lady neuter, she has excellent type and size. Excellent head slightly longer than wide, with balanced length from ear to nasal bridge and tip of nose, broad nose of uniform width with a shallow curve at the nasal bridge, nose tip rolls off slightly but lines up with her deep strong chin, muzzle square and broad. Full cheeks and high cheek bones. Ears large and tall with good width at the base and tapering to a pointed tufted tip, set high on the head with good width between. Round eyes with oblique setting, colour yellowish green. Long well-muscled body with very good breadth to chest, strong legs in proportion with large round paws showing long backward facing toe tufts, super tail beautifully plumed and of balancing length. Coat medium in length with full frontal ruff, has distinct flowing glossy top coat with soft undercoat and full shaggy breeches and tummy. Colouring very attractive, jet black tabby on warm agouti ground, overlain with rich red tortie, white mainly to chest tummy and paws. head with lovely walnut shaped eyes, very beguiling with the gentlest of expressions. A pleasure to handle. British Grand Premier GD Proctor s PR HEATHDOWN LEONARDO DAVINCI (BRI ny 12) MN 26/03/17. A handsome lad, well developed and a decent size for 14 months. Round head with full cheeks, ears small neat and rounded at the tips and nicely set, good breadth to the skull, rounded forehead, short nose, firm chin and level bite. Large round eyes, open in expression and mid green in colour. Medium length body, compact and weighty, with fairly broad chest and low hind quarters, short legs and tail to balance. Black tipping to surface of coat, mainly even throughout, just a slightly more solid line down the spine, with lovely warm apricot undercoat. Coat rather long but is very dense and it has a hint of crispness to it. Excellent temperament and presentation. Tabby Colourpoint Persian Neuter PC & BOB Willis CRYSTALMIST LATIN LYNDSEY (PER b 21 33) MN 01/04/16. A good sized neuter, type generally good although he is marginally long in the forehead for head balance. Skull fairly broad and nice and smooth, ears are small, but have rather long hairs at the tips distorting the rounded shape, set well apart and fitting the head well. Good stop and a short snub nose with full nose leather and open nostrils, strong chin, bite a touch under. Large round eyes and they are a good blue. Medium length body, cobby in type with plenty of substance, short legs with good bone, round tufted paws and a short brush tail. Darker chocolate tabby markings to points, well defined on the face, paler on the legs and tail rings just seen when shaken out. Coat of acceptable length given the time of year, slight frill to face and there is some fullness on the body with texture soft and fine, but the underbody lacks preparation. Australian Mist Neuter BOB Newton s GRPR HILDREK DREAM-SEEKA (AUS b 24) FN 18/10/14. A lovely lady neuter, super size and she conforms really well to type. Moderate wedge with wide cheek bones, broad muzzle and well defined whisker pads, nicely rounded top, with her medium sized ears set to follow the upper part of the face with a slightly forward tilt. Large lustrous eyes, nicely shaped for open expression and with an oblique set, colour mid green. moderate dip to a broad nose of even width, good deep chin lines up with the nose tip and the bite is level. Substantial body with her waistline a touch larger than ideal but does have a very good tone to it, her chest is broad and rounded, with slender legs of medium length, tail with minimal taper to a rounded tip needs just a touch more length for balance. She has excellent pattern, with her warm chocolate spotting heavily invaded with agouti and giving the desired misted effect. Nice short coat with some undercoat to give the desired resilient effect, gleaming with health and condition. Handled well and was excellently presented Oriental Bicolour SH or LH Adult BOB Wood s CH ROSEAU SNAPE (OSH c 02 61) M 30/03/17. Not the largest of males and somewhat effeminate, he is nevertheless a very stylish boy. Longer wedge with very good width to the top of head and large flared ears set to balance. Almost straight profile, firm chin and level bite. Oriental eye shape and set with good depth of blue given the extreme amount of white he has. Long neck and a long elegant but well muscled body, long legs and neat paws, long whip tail to balance. Very high white with no colour on the head, has just a small pale lilac patch on the rump and a mainly lilac tail, however, he is not what it says on the tin! I have judged him several times and said so in my subsequent reports, so strictly speaking, as the registration has not been changed, I really should withhold on him. He displays all the signs of being pointed rather than solid as I have stated before, he is also a very high white, so 02, which is harlequin and about 65% white, is not correct. He really needs to be DNA tested, and if proven wrong I will happily apologise, but I think you will find that he has two copies of the cs gene. Slightly tense today but handled okay.
